Man Charged With OWI In Montville Wrong-Way Wreck: State Police
A man has been charged following a wreck on the I-395 offramp late Monday night.
MONTVILLE, CT — A man has been charged following a wrong-way crash on the offramp of I-395 southbound in Montville on Monday night, according to state police. No one was injured in the two-car wreck.
State police said a 2008 Mercury Milan Premier entered the offramp from Route 2A going the wrong way at 11:33 p.m. and sideswiped a 2009 Mercedes Benz E3504m.
James Tanner, 46, of Colchester, was charged with operating a motor vehicle under the influence of drugs or alcohol, failure to drive in proper lane, and driving the wrong way on a divided highway.

He was given a $1,500 non-surety bond and scheduled to appear in court Feb. 25 in Norwich.
